Suwannee County hears Water First North Florida pitch as residents raise water-quality and local-control concerns Suwannee County commissioners heard a presentation Feb. 17 from the Suwannee River Water Management District on the Water First North Florida reclaimed-water aquifer-recharge project, which would deliver about 40 million gallons per day and is still in early siting and design. Dozens of residents pressed officials about contaminants, PFAS, nitrate limits and whether counties have any formal vote on the state-led plan.

Suwannee County moves to expand community paramedic program with opioid‑settlement funds Chief Miller briefed the board on a CORE initiative using opioid settlement dollars to expand community paramedics; the county was earmarked $775,000 in year one, asked to allocate about $467,000 to five full‑time positions, and commissioners gave consensus to proceed pending finalized contracts and a written sustainability plan.

Suwannee County approves purchase of US‑129 South property for future government use, funds purchase with CARES/ARPA The board voted 4‑0 to buy the Fisher property on US‑129 South (listed at $11,750 per acre; roughly 94 acres cited in public comment), authorizing the chairman to execute closing documents and directing county staff to use CARES/ARPA funds rather than a line of credit to fund the purchase.

Commission rejects sole bid for Catalyst site wastewater plant; staff to rebid with revised phasing and alternates The board authorized rejection of the sole, high bid received for bid #2025‑28 (Catalyst site wastewater treatment plant) and directed staff to revise the bid package with phasing and alternates and re‑advertise; county staff will consider bridging options if future bids exceed available funds.

County audit flags repeated deficiencies in sheriffs office; subpoena seeks records tied to Mills Gas and Diesel Independent auditors gave Suwannee County a clean opinion on its 2023–24 financial statements but identified eight findings, including repeated weaknesses in the sheriffs office. Separately, county attorney told the board a subpoena seeks county records related to Mills Gas and Diesel after a search warrant was executed there.
